Installer PMB 7.3.2 sur Linux

Je suis au Brésil et j'aimerais installer PMB dans la bibliothèque où je travaille.
Où puis-je trouver la documentation ou le tutoriel pour installer PMB 7.3 pour Linux?

Désolé si mon français est faux. Je suis en train d'utiliser Google Traduction

Réponses

  • septembre 2020 modifié
    Olá

    J'essaie d'installer PMB 7.3.4 sur Windows 10 et également sur linux Debian 10.
    Pour le moment je ne suis pas arrivé à avoir une version fonctionnelle de PMB.
    Je ne suis malheureusement pas expert dans le domaine, mais il doit s'en trouver
    de nombreux pour vous aider en cas de problème sur ce site communautaire du
    logiciel libre PMB.
    Pour l'installation linux je me suis basé sur les post suivants :
    et 

    Boa sorte
  • Bonsoir,
    Voici une installation qui fonctionne sur Ubuntu 18.04 lts

    Install PMB7.3.4 sur Ubuntu 18,04 lts

    L’installation ici est faite sur LAMP

    Apache/2.4.29 (Ubuntu)

    Serveur Mysql

    • Version du client de base de données : libmysql - mysqlnd 5.0.12-dev - 20150407 - $Id: 3591daad22de08524295e1bd073aceeff11e6579 $

    • Extension PHP : mysqli curl mbstring

    • Version de PHP : 7.2.24-0ubuntu0.18.04.6

    • PhpMyAdmin Version : 4.6.6deb5

    préalablement à l’installation de pmb7.3.4, la base de donnée sql est importée dans PhpMyAdmin dans une nouvelle base nommée bibli

    N’est abordé ici que la désinstallation d’une ancienne version de Pmb et une réinstallation

    1- Désinstallation

    christalain@christalain-K70IJ:~$ sudo rm -rf /var/www/html/pmb/

    2- réinstallation

    christalain@christalain-K70IJ:~$ sudo cp -r /home/christalain/Téléchargements/pmb/ /var/www/html/

    3- modifier le propriétaire et le groupe des fichiers

    christalain@christalain-K70IJ:~$ sudo chown -R www-data: www-data /var/www/html/pmb

    4- créer 2 fichiers de configuration

    christalain@christalain-K70IJ:~$ sudo -i

    [sudo] Mot de passe de christalain :

    root@christalain-K70IJ:~# cd /var/www/html/pmb/includes/

    root@christalain-K70IJ:/var/www/html/pmb/includes# cp -i db_param.inc.php_example db_param.inc.php

    root@christalain-K70IJ:/var/www/html/pmb/includes# chown www-data:www-data db_param.inc.php

    root@christalain-K70IJ:/var/www/html/pmb/includes# cd

    root@christalain-K70IJ:~# cd /var/www/html/pmb/opac_css/includes/

    root@christalain-K70IJ:/var/www/html/pmb/opac_css/includes# cp -i opac_db_param.inc.php_example opac_db_param.inc.php

    root@christalain-K70IJ:/var/www/html/pmb/opac_css/includes# chown www-data:www-data opac_db_param.inc.php

    root@christalain-K70IJ:/var/www/html/pmb/opac_css/includes# cd

    root@christalain-K70IJ:~# exit

    Conseil : éviter d’éditer ces fichiers pour ne pas les corrompre.

    5-Vérification de la taille des 2 fichiers :

    sudo ls -l /var/www/html/pmb/includes/db_param.inc.*

    -rwxr-xr-x 1 www-data www-data 2561 août 21 19:42 /var/www/html/pmb/includes/db_param.inc.php

    -rwxrwxr-x 1 www-data www-data 2561 août 21 15:36 /var/www/html/pmb/includes/db_param.inc.php_example

    sudo ls -l /var/www/html/pmb/opac_css/includes/opac_db_param.inc.*

    -rwxr-xr-x 1 www-data www-data 2809 août 21 19:50 /var/www/html/pmb/opac_css/includes/opac_db_param.inc.php

    -rwxrwxr-x 1 www-data www-data 2809 août 21 15:35 /var/www/html/pmb/opac_css/includes/opac_db_param.inc.php_example


    la taille des fichiers doit être identique

    6- modifier le fichier au besoin pour augmenter la taille maximum de l’import dans PhpMyAdmin:

    modif fichier php.ini : sudo gedit /etc/php/7.2/apache2/php.ini post_max_size=250 ; upload_max_filesize=250 ; max_imput_vars 1000 passer à 2000

    Ensuite, il suffit de redémarrer apache : service apache2 restart

    Astuce : au besoin vérifier dans apache les erreurs : sudo tail -f /var/log/apache2/error.log

    C’est le moment d’aller dans son navigateur et saisir dans la barre d’adresse :

    localhost/pmb/tables/install.php

    Cordialement

    RaultBiblio



Connectez-vous ou Inscrivez-vous pour répondre.